Postby westozfalcon » Tue Aug 13, 2013 10:56 pm

Brisbane has made the right decision here.

Voss just hasn't been able to get the team playing consistently well and 5 years is plenty of time to do that.

People may point to those dramatic come-from-behind wins against Geelong and North Melbourne as evidence of turning the corner but you have to ask why we were falling behind so far in the first place.

Hopefully we don't go for another 'favourite son' like Lappin or Leppitsch. It rarely works.
